SQL Server网络端口配置
在进行SQL Server的网络端口配置时,需要了解一些基本的知识。本文将从端口号、TCP/IP协议和SQL Server配置等方面,详细介绍SQL Server网络端口配置相关的知识。
1. 端口号
端口号是用于标识不同应用程序或服务的唯一标识符,是在网络通信过程中使用的一种技术。在TCP/IP协议中,端口号分为三类,其中0~1023的端口号称为知名端口号(Well-Known Ports),是预留给一些特定的服务和应用程序使用的;1024~49151的端口号称为注册端口号(Registered Ports),是供用户使用的,但需遵循某些规定;49152~65535的端口号称为动态端口号(Dynamic Ports),是系统自动分配的。
SQL Server的默认端口号为1433,该端口号属于知名端口号,如果需要更改SQL Server的端口号,可以通过SQL Server配置管理器进行配置。
2. TCP/IP协议
TCP/IP协议是一个协议集合,是互联网通信的标准协议。其中TCP协议是一种面向连接的协议,提供了可靠的数据传输和错误恢复机制;而UDP协议则是一种无连接的协议,传输速度快,但不能保证数据传输的可靠性。在SQL Server中,使用TCP/IP协议进行网络通信。
2.1 SQL Server使用TCP/IP协议的例子
USE master
GO
EXEC sp_configure 'show advanced options', 1;
GO
RECONFIGURE;
GO
EXEC sp_configure 'remote access', 1;
GO
RECONFIGURE;
GO
EXEC sp_configure 'remote query timeout', 600;
GO
RECONFIGURE;
GO
在上面的例子中,使用TCP/IP协议连接SQL Server。
3. SQL Server配置
在SQL Server中,可以通过配置管理器进行网络端口的配置。具体步骤如下:
3.1 打开SQL Server配置管理器
在开始菜单中搜索SQL Server Configuration Manager并打开。
3.2 启用TCP/IP协议
在SQL Server配置管理器中,依次展开“SQL Server网络配置”、“协议”下的“TCP/IP”选项卡,将该协议启用。
3.3 配置端口号
在TCP/IP属性中,选择“IP地址”选项卡,在列表中选择“IPAll”选项卡,在TCP动态端口区域中输入所需端口号。
3.4 重启SQL Server服务
在完成端口号的配置后,需要重启SQL Server服务才能生效。
4. 总结
SQL Server网络端口配置是进行网络通信时必须要进行的操作。在配置过程中,需要了解端口号和TCP/IP协议知识,并通过SQL Server配置管理器进行端口号的配置。希望本文对SQL Server网络端口配置有所帮助。